    quintillion

    English

    Numeral

    (head)
  • A billion billion: 1 followed by eighteen zeros, 1018.
  • * 2014 , BBC News Magazine Monitor, Small Data: Those big numbers keep on coming , BBC:
  • Last week, we used...the BBC News website's biggest number: 9,223,372,036,854,775,808, that's 9.2 quintillion...[the maximum video viewer count on YouTube's] updated counter software.
  • A million quadrillion: 1 followed by 30 zeros, 1030.
